Output 8512909cbb8441414786426e2376256a5f5bac91727bc3273bcc7bf18c9bdae8:0

value
27061528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e6dcf73566a9bf0a5fa2311ff6b42e33b52b0e1 OP_EQUAL
address
M9DTEsaqgoGCa4R7RsssEEWHLujC92BgSi
transaction
8512909cbb8441414786426e2376256a5f5bac91727bc3273bcc7bf18c9bdae8
spent
true